Email us at LocalNewsLab [@] The amount of neighborhood political insurance coverage correlates with increased citizen turnover. Researchers in Denmark located that "regional news media insurance coverage has a favorable effect on voter yield, however only if the information media supply politically relevant details to the citizens and only at neighborhood elections." Voters have been more most likely to enact down-ballot races in locations with more neighborhood papers per capita.


Olaf University located that even the presence of local newspapers adds to the likelihood that citizens will certainly load out more of their tallies. Local media protection can raise voter involvement in state Supreme Court elections. David Hughes researched how these races can frequently be taken into consideration "low info political elections" as a result of just how little details voters can discover about the candidates and risks of the pop over to this site contest, however limelights can produce and distribute as much information regarding a race as a well-funded project.

Consuming local journalism is associated with regular voting in neighborhood elections and a strong connection to area. Church bench Proving ground experts located in 2016 that more than a quarter of united state adults say they constantly enact neighborhood elections, and they also have "noticeably more powerful" regional information routines than people who do not vote in your area regularly.

When a major journalistic resource of information declines or vanishes, there are enormous results on regional political involvement. This has occurred in hundreds of neighborhoods where there have been large declines in local information. Danny Hayes and Jennifer L. Lawless additionally discovered that the "burrowing" of American papers over three decades including a significant decrease in the quantity of local news generated by newspapers of all sizes, with one of the most severe cuts in regional federal government and school coverage had huge effects on neighborhood political engagement, consisting of lowered political understanding, and much less passion in political involvement.
